Azeri public got carried away by abusing Turkey

PanARMENIAN.Net - Azeri public got carried away by abusing Turkey over possible opening of the Armenian-Turkish border, an Azeri expert said.



"Turkey is Azerbaijan's strategic partner. It's inadmissible to set public against this country," Ilgar Mammadov said. "If we continue the same way, Azerbaijan will get closer to Russia and divert from its European course," he said, 1news.az reports.
